About Jiahn‐Jyh Chen

Jiahn‐Jyh Chen is a scholar working on Psychiatry and Mental health, Toxicology and Geriatrics and Gerontology, having authored 15 papers that have together received 152 indexed citations. Recurring topics across this work include Schizophrenia research and treatment (6 papers), Bipolar Disorder and Treatment (4 papers) and Dementia and Cognitive Impairment Research (3 papers). The work is most often cited by research in Psychiatry and Mental health (92 citations), Biological Psychiatry (14 citations) and Biochemistry (28 citations). Jiahn‐Jyh Chen has collaborated with scholars based in Taiwan, United States and South Korea. Frequent co-authors include Hung‐Yu Chan, Hai‐Gwo Hwu, Ching‐Jui Chang, Susan Shur‐Fen Gau, Yi‐Ju Pan, Shu‐Chuan Chiang, Mei‐Shu Lai, Tzung‐Jeng Hwang, Ming H. Hsieh and Wen‐Hung Chung. Their work appears in journals such as Psychiatry Research, Schizophrenia Research and The Journal of Clinical Psychiatry.
